~My Bio~

 

Hello. My name is Skye Ashley. I am originally from New York City, currently residing in the Bay Area in Northern California.

I first became impassioned about pregnancy and birth after reading Ina May Gaskin’s classic book, “Spiritual Midwifery”. It profoundly changed the way I look at birth, most especially the way in which we view birth as a culture.

In 1993, I attended The Boulder College of Massage Therapy, and while there created a program providing massage therapy, infant massage, and lessons around healing touch to pregnant and postpartum teens. After completing 1200 hours in a variety of modalities I graduated with honors as a Certified Massage Therapist.

I created a successful massage practice encompassing renowned clients and spas in New York City, Seattle, and San Francisco. During this time I massaged hundreds of women through the stages of their pregnancies and have taught Mother’s Massage, Infant Massage, and Prenatal Partner Yoga/Massage Workshops to expectant couples and new parents.

I became a Certified Yoga Teacher in 1996, after completing a 250+ hour training at the Sivananda Yoga Vedanta Centre/Ashram in Montreal. In 2004 I completed a six-month apprenticeship in prenatal yoga at 8Limbs Yoga Center and have taught prenatal yoga classes at 8Limbs Yoga Center and Lotus Yoga, both in Seattle, Washington, and at The Yoga and Movement Center in Walnut Creek, California.

I became a DONA Certified Birth Doula after studying at Seattle Midwifery School, while pregnant with my first child in 2002, as a way to better understand the process and magic of birth. I later taught childbirth preparation classes at Big Belly Services for several years, after completing a Level I training and a one-year apprenticeship with a certified mentor. I am currently working toward my mentor certification in Birthing From Within.

I hold a B.F.A. from Adelphi University in Garden City, New York, and after a career in the theatre, I pursued Graduate Studies in Somatic Psychology at Naropa University in Boulder, Colorado. I currently hold a teaching credential in Parent Education from the State of California.

I was a student-in-residence at the Esalen Institute in Big Sur, California where I further enriched my group facilitation skills. I have traveled extensively throughout North America, Europe, the Middle East, Asia, and the Pacific Rim.

I founded LOTUS birth services in 2004 as a way to synthesize my experiences in support of my vision, a prayer that someday all women will feel transformed and empowered by their journeys into birth and motherhood. I believe that entering the world in a way that is held as powerful and sacred greatly informs how we later choose to walk the earth.

My most profound life’s work is as a wife to Christopher and mother to my two children, Amitiel Roan and Tara Kali Sian.
